  • Patent number: 12291915
    Abstract: A system for opening or closing a closure member of a vehicle and an accelerometer calibration method are provided. The system includes an actuator assembly with an electric motor operably coupled to an extensible member for opening or closing the closure member. The system also includes an accelerometer configured to sense movement of the closure member and output an accelerometer signal. An actuator controller is coupled to electric motor and to the accelerometer and is configured to determine an adjusted accelerometer signal as the accelerometer signal adjusted using one of a plurality of predetermined compensation factors determined through an accelerometer calibration process temporally before installation of the accelerometer in the vehicle. The actuator controller then controls the opening or closing of the closure member using the electric motor based on the movement of the closure member as represented by the adjusted accelerometer signal.

  • Patent number: 12146361
    Abstract: A system and method for controlling motion of a door are provided. The door is moveable between an open position and a closed position and has a balanced position whereat the door does not move towards the open position nor the closed position under an effect of gravity. The system includes a power actuator for moving the door to a partially open position between the open position and the closed position. The power actuator is adapted to allow the door to move to the balanced position after the power actuator has moved the door to the partially open position.

  • Publication number: 20240352782
    Abstract: A method and a device for closing a door on a door opening of a vehicle are provided. The closing device includes a seal formed between the door and the door opening for separating an interior space and an exterior space from each other when the door is in a closed position. The device also includes a door drive for moving the door and a controller coupled to the door drive for controlling movement of the door based on an operating request of a user. The controller includes a condition monitoring unit configured to determine and use at least one variable state variable chosen from the group consisting of the device, the door, the door opening, and the installation environment of the door. The controller is configured to generate a value of at least one closing parameter for closing the door depending on the at least one variable state variable.

  • Publication number: 20240328230
    Abstract: An actuator system for a closure panel of a vehicle and method of operation are provided. The system includes a biasing member adapted to apply a biasing member force to the closure panel. The system also includes an actuator assembly comprising an actuator housing. The actuator assembly also includes a motor disposed in the actuator housing and configured to rotate a motor shaft operably coupled to an extensible member coupled to one of a body and the closure panel for opening or closing the closure panel. The system also includes an actuator controller configured to control the motor to output an adjusted force based on the biasing member force to move the closure panel.

  • Publication number: 20230265704
    Abstract: A power door actuation system for a door of a vehicle is provided. The system includes a housing mounted to the door and an actuator mounted within the housing that includes an electric motor configured to output a motor force. The actuator also includes a geartrain with a geartrain input coupled to an output of the electric motor for receiving the motor force and a geartrain output for applying an output force to the door. An extendible member is configured for extension and retraction in response to actuation by the geartrain output for moving the door. The system determines the output force to compensate for external forces affecting the motion of the door, adjusts the output force determined to an adjusted output force to compensate for internal forces affecting the operation of the actuator, and controls the electric motor to move the door at the adjusted output force.

  • Publication number: 20230184020
    Abstract: An actuator assembly of an actuation system for a closure member of a vehicle is provided. The actuator assembly includes an actuator housing including a sensor housing. The actuator assembly also includes an electric motor disposed in the actuator housing and configured to rotate a driven shaft operably coupled to an extensible member that is coupled to one of a body or the closure member for opening or closing the closure member. The actuator assembly also includes an actuator controller disposed in the sensor housing of the actuator housing and coupled to electric motor and an accelerometer configured to sense movement of the closure member. The actuator controller is configured to detect the movement of the closure member using the accelerometer. The actuator controller then controls the opening or closing of the closure member based on the movement of the closure member using the electric motor.
